What Is Leverage?
Leverage is the use of borrowed funds, margin, collateral, or derivative exposure to control a position larger than the trader’s own capital.
In crypto, leverage is most often used in margin trading, futures, perpetual contracts, options, collateralized borrowing, and some DeFi strategies.
A user who applies leverage can increase market exposure without paying the full value of the position upfront.
For example, a trader with $1,000 who opens a $5,000 position is using 5x leverage.
This can increase potential gains when the market moves in the user’s favor.
It can also increase losses when the market moves against the user.
The CFTC virtual currency risk advisory warns that virtual currency products and strategies can be risky, volatile, and difficult to understand.
How Leverage Works in Crypto
Leverage works by using a smaller amount of capital to support a larger position.
The user deposits margin or collateral, and the trading system allows a larger exposure based on that collateral.
The position size is the total market value controlled by the user.
The margin is the amount of capital used to support that position.
The leverage ratio is calculated by dividing position size by margin.
If a user deposits $2,000 and controls a $20,000 position, the leverage ratio is 10x.
At 10x leverage, a 1% price move can create an approximate 10% change in the user’s margin before fees, funding, and other costs.
Why Leverage Matters
Leverage matters because it changes the relationship between price movement and account results.
In spot trading, a 5% move in the asset usually creates a 5% change in the value of that asset position.
In a 10x leveraged position, a 5% adverse move can create a much larger loss relative to the user’s margin.
This is why leverage is sometimes attractive to active traders.
It is also why leverage is dangerous for users who do not understand liquidation, volatility, margin rules, and fees.
Leverage does not make a trade more likely to be correct.
It only makes the result of the trade larger compared with the capital committed.
Leverage Ratio
The leverage ratio shows how many times larger the position is compared with the margin used.
Common examples include 2x, 3x, 5x, 10x, 20x, and higher levels depending on product rules.
Lower leverage gives a position more room before liquidation.
Higher leverage places the liquidation price closer to the entry price.
At 2x leverage, a position can usually survive more normal price movement than at 20x leverage.
At very high leverage, even a small market wick can force the position to close.
A high leverage ratio should be treated as a high-risk setting, not as a sign of advanced skill.
Margin and Collateral
Margin is the capital that supports a leveraged position.
Collateral is the asset pledged to secure borrowing, debt, or trading exposure.
The Investor.gov margin account glossary explains that margin can increase buying power but also increase potential losses.
In crypto, margin or collateral may be held in stablecoins, BTC, ETH, or another accepted asset depending on the product.
Initial margin is the amount required to open the position.
Maintenance margin is the minimum equity required to keep the position open.
The CME Group futures margin guide explains that futures margin is money a trader must deposit and keep available while holding a futures position.
Liquidation
Liquidation is the forced closing or reduction of a leveraged position when the user no longer has enough margin or collateral.
A leveraged long position can be liquidated when the asset price falls too far.
A leveraged short position can be liquidated when the asset price rises too far.
The Investor.gov margin call glossary explains that a firm can require more funds or sell assets when account equity becomes too low.
In crypto, liquidation can happen very quickly because markets trade continuously and prices can move sharply.
A user may lose most or all of the margin assigned to the position.
Liquidation can also include extra fees, poor execution, funding costs, and slippage.
Leverage in Long and Short Positions
A leveraged long position is used when a trader expects the price of a crypto asset to rise.
If the price rises, the long position gains value.
If the price falls, the long position loses value and may be liquidated.
A leveraged short position is used when a trader expects the price of a crypto asset to fall.
If the price falls, the short position gains value.
If the price rises, the short position loses value and may be liquidated.
Short positions can be especially risky during fast upward moves because traders may be forced to buy back exposure at higher prices.
Leverage in Futures and Perpetual Contracts
Crypto leverage is commonly used through futures and perpetual contracts.
A futures contract gives price exposure under contract terms that may include an expiration date.
A perpetual contract gives price exposure without a fixed expiration date.
Perpetual contracts often use funding payments to keep the contract price close to the underlying spot price.
If funding is positive, long traders may pay short traders.
If funding is negative, short traders may pay long traders.
Funding costs can make a leveraged position more expensive to hold over time.
Leverage in DeFi Borrowing
Leverage can also appear in DeFi lending and borrowing.
A user may deposit collateral, borrow another asset, and use the borrowed asset to increase market exposure.
For example, a user could deposit ETH, borrow a stablecoin, buy more ETH, and increase exposure to ETH price movement.
This creates leveraged exposure because the user now has both collateral risk and debt risk.
The Aave liquidation guide explains that a borrow position can be liquidated when its health factor falls below required levels.
DeFi leverage can be transparent and programmable, but it can also be complex.
Users must understand collateral value, debt value, interest rates, oracle prices, liquidation thresholds, and smart contract risk.
Isolated Leverage
Isolated leverage means the margin assigned to one position is separated from the rest of the account.
If the isolated position is liquidated, the loss is usually limited to the margin assigned to that position.
This can make risk easier to measure.
For example, a user may assign $300 of margin to one leveraged trade and keep other account funds separate.
If the trade fails, the isolated margin can be lost without automatically using the entire account balance.
Isolated leverage is often easier for less experienced users to understand.
However, isolated leverage can still cause large losses if the user uses high leverage or repeatedly adds margin without a plan.
Cross Leverage
Cross leverage uses available account equity to support one or more open positions.
This can give a position a larger margin buffer.
It can also put more of the account balance at risk if the market moves against the user.
Cross leverage may be useful for advanced traders who manage several positions together.
It can be dangerous for users who do not understand portfolio-level exposure.
A position may survive longer under cross margin, but the final loss can affect more funds.
Users should check whether a position uses isolated or cross margin before confirming any leveraged trade.
Benefits of Leverage
The first benefit of leverage is capital efficiency.
A user can control larger exposure without placing the full position value into the trade.
The second benefit is flexibility.
Leverage can be used for long trades, short trades, hedging, and short-term strategies.
The third benefit is hedging.
A user who owns spot crypto may use a short leveraged position to reduce downside exposure during uncertain markets.
These benefits are useful only when the user understands the risk and uses a clear plan.
Risks of Leverage
The main risk of leverage is that losses are amplified.
A small market move can create a large account loss when leverage is high.
The second risk is liquidation.
The third risk is funding cost or borrowing cost.
The fourth risk is slippage during fast or illiquid market conditions.
The fifth risk is emotional overtrading after quick gains or losses.
The sixth risk is misunderstanding margin mode, liquidation price, or collateral requirements.
Leverage and Volatility
Crypto markets can be volatile because prices can change rapidly in response to liquidity, news, macro conditions, liquidations, and market sentiment.
Leverage makes volatility more dangerous because it magnifies each price move against the user’s margin.
A normal spot-market fluctuation can become a major leveraged loss.
A short price wick can trigger liquidation even if the market later returns to the earlier level.
Volatility can also cause wider spreads and worse execution.
During extreme moves, stop orders may not fill at the expected price.
This is why leverage should usually be reduced when volatility increases.
Leverage and Fees
Leverage can make fees more important because fees are often calculated on position size rather than margin size.
A trading fee that looks small compared with the full position can be large compared with the user’s margin.
Funding payments can also reduce returns when a perpetual position is held for many funding periods.
Borrowing interest can reduce returns in margin or DeFi leverage strategies.
Liquidation fees can make a forced exit more expensive.
Slippage can add hidden cost when liquidity is thin.
A user should calculate total cost before opening a leveraged position.
How to Measure Leverage Risk
Start by checking the leverage ratio.
Next, compare the entry price with the liquidation price.
Then review the position size compared with total account equity.
Check whether the position uses isolated margin or cross margin.
Review maintenance margin, funding rates, fees, and expected holding time.
For DeFi leverage, check health factor, LTV, liquidation threshold, oracle source, and collateral liquidity.
A leveraged position should not be opened unless the user knows how much can be lost if the trade fails.
Common Misunderstandings About Leverage
One common misunderstanding is that leverage increases only profit.
In reality, leverage increases both profit and loss potential.
Another misunderstanding is that lower margin means lower risk.
Lower margin usually means higher leverage and a closer liquidation price.
A third misunderstanding is that stop-loss orders remove liquidation risk.
Stop-loss orders can help, but they may execute poorly or fail during fast markets.
A fourth misunderstanding is that DeFi leverage is safer because it happens onchain.
Onchain transparency does not remove smart contract risk, oracle risk, liquidity risk, or liquidation risk.
